Форум программистов, компьютерный форум CyberForum.ru

классы.посмотрите пожалуйста) -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 подскажите пожалуйста, что не так? http://www.cyberforum.ru/cpp-beginners/thread291990.html
Здравствуйте. У меня вопрос по поводу задачи: найти букву, чаще встречающуюся в тексте. Т.е. я ввожу массив из элементов, записываю в матрицу не повторяющиеся элементы *если есть эл-ты, которые повторяются, я увеличиваю кол-во, которое уже есть в матрице * после, ищу эл-т с наибольшим кол-ом и вывожу его, при том само кол-во выводить не обязательно. там еще такая путаница с типами...
C++ Обработка одномерных элементов есть код для задачи: Преобразовать заданный массив целых положительных чисел F(n) таким образом, чтобы цифры каждого его элемента были записаны в обратном порядке. Определить количество простых чисел в массиве до и после преобразования. После преобразования удалить из массива максимальный элемент. #include <iostream> #include <algorithm> #include <vector> bool is_prime(const int n){ ... http://www.cyberforum.ru/cpp-beginners/thread291979.html
указатель на функцию C++
Функция должна сортировать и по возрастанию,и по убыванию с помощью бинарных предикатов.И ещё отсортировать элементы массива по возрастанию их синуса. Программа работает только в одном случае,а для синусов вообще не работает. Объясните,в чём моя ошибка,а точнее,как сделать,чтобы функция сортировала правильно для всех трёх случаев. #include "stdafx.h" #include <conio.h> #include <iostream>...
C++ Матрица, последовательность, координаты
Здравствуйте, помогите решить в Си 1) Прочитать текстовый файл и подсчитать количество слов в нём (слова разделены пробелами, запятыми и точками). Имя файла передаётся через командную строку. 2) Вводится последовательность целых чисел и записывается в двусвязный список. Удалить из этого списка элементы с минимальным значением. 3) Написать программу для определения положения точки с...
C++ Умножение матриц http://www.cyberforum.ru/cpp-beginners/thread291970.html
Задача такая : Для заданой квадратической матрицы А заданого порядка n найти произведение А * В, где элементы матрицы В узнаются за формулой : Bij = 1/(i+j-1) i.j = целые больше ноля Вот что получилось: #include <iostream> #include <cstdlib> #include <stdio.h> #include <conio.h> using namespace std;
C++ Возврат строки из функции по указателю Здравствуйте. Обьясните пожалуйсто, почему компилятор выдает предупреждение при выполнении следующего кода и почему строка возвращается не полностью ? #include "windows.h" #include <iostream> using namespace std; char *func() { char arr="stro4ka"; return arr; подробнее

Показать сообщение отдельно
Парапулька
0 / 0 / 0
Регистрация: 04.12.2010
Сообщений: 25

классы.посмотрите пожалуйста) - C++

09.05.2011, 21:46. Просмотров 745. Ответов 10
Метки (Все метки)

ребят
вот проблема у меня возникла
написала программу по этому заданию:
Создать класс int3, имитирующий стандартный тип. Написать программу, в которой будут созданы 3 объекта класса int3, два из которых будут инициализированы. Сложите два инициализированных объекта, присвойте результат третьему и отобразите результат на экране.
Но мой преподаватель её жутко раскритиковал
наговорил море каких-то не очень понятных для меня-новичка слов
и значит сказал переделывать
вот текст моей программы
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
#include <iostream>
#include <cmath>
using namespace std;
class int3
{
public: 
        int a;
        int b;
        int ();
        int3(int,int);
        int sum();
};
int main()
{       int n;
         int3 chislo(3,4);
cout << "chislo a = " << chislo.a << endl;
cout << "chislo b = " << chislo.b << endl;
cout << chislo.sum()<<endl;
  cin >> n;
}
int3::int3(int int1, int int2)
    {
    a=int1;
    b=int2;
    }
int int3::sum()
    {
    return a+b;
    }
прошу помогите,разъясните в чём же тут у меня какие недочёты
только прошу разъяснять не на уровне профессионала,
а всего лишь новичка)
спасибо заранее кто откликнется)
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
 
Текущее время: 21:38.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ru